Transaction 64dffc69987abb9708cec331bb2f91dba819366eb3a578ee8ae56dfadcf01375

1 Input
2 Outputs
  • 64dffc69987abb9708cec331bb2f91dba819366eb3a578ee8ae56dfadcf01375:0
  • value  80128203
    address  17X1oFSPuBS5bpXPxGgNeYpFvUQAVcoP7b
  • 64dffc69987abb9708cec331bb2f91dba819366eb3a578ee8ae56dfadcf01375:1
  • value  1795734726
    address  1L6ybWym11nEF3Xzh5uNMwQC2oxUAu7Gxh